- >> I want to model/animate a banner-object (like a looong trail of paper)
- >> waving through the air.
- >> Any suggestions how this could best be done?
- >
- > Build the banner.
- >
- > Triple it.
- >
- > Subdivide it.
- >
- > Subdivide it again.
- >
- > Subdivide it again.
- >
- > Export it.
- >
- > Set a fractal bump displacment map.
- >
- > Play with the velocity for movement.
- >
- > Set the amplitude to your liking.
- >
- > Use Falloff so the one side of the banner
- > that is being held by, let's say, a pole, has
- > less to no movement.
-
-
- Add some bones to make major, wrap-around macro-flapping action, and
- then.....
-
- > Play with the values till it looks right.
- > There you go.
